EGYPT, Alexandria. Hadrian. AD 117-138. BI Tetradrachm (23mm, 12.38 g, 12h). Dated RY 21 (AD 136/7). Laureate head left / Triptolemus driving biga of winged serpents right; L KA (date) around. Köln 1212; Dattari (Savio) 1484 var. (date arrangement); K&G 32.723; RPC III 6135; Emmett 900.21. Toned, porosity, some peripheral weakness. VF. Rare and popular type.

From the Dr. Thomas E. Beniak Collection, purchased from Holyland Numismatics, 23 April 2010.
